This is the House remix, but this track have been made in many versions, as he often use the pattern for tutorials or showing synths on TikTok. The first released version titled Bluescream or Blue Scream is more Techno Acid, the digital one, and is named after that distortion pedal on the cover. Born and raised in the scenic town of Lillehammer, Norway, Chent is a rapidly-rising house musician known for his incredible remixes and unique analog sound. Inspired by legendary artists like Daft Punk and deadmau5, he began releasing electronic music in 2017, however he started DJing at an early age and has been quickly gaining a devoted following ever since. Chent's music reflects his passion for music, incorporating intricate rhythms, driving beats, and a sound that's both vintage and modern.
